Direct Thermal or Thermal Transfer Printer?

For printing involves shipping postage and labeling, you will need printer. Two popular printer types are direct thermal and thermal transfer. The obvious difference is the thermal transfer require extra wax or resin based ribbon and direct thermal will not.

Post-process Product Pictures of eCommerce Website

For online merchants engaged in ecommerce, processing the product pictures after being photographed is a common task. A technique called “clipping” can be used to extract the product from background and is introduced inside Adobe Photoshop. Together with the eraser tool, you can achieve the rather simple task of extracting an object from the original photographed background and onto a cleaner one.
